Family Program

We at LCS are committed to assisting families in their time of need. Our family program is designed to empower and improve families. Each family has requirements they must meet. The requirements include, but are not limited to:
Each participant must sign a contract with the Family Program case manager that agrees to the following:
  • Participation in the Back To Work program, or other programs such as workforce center or life skills.
  • Participation in the LCS Family Program savings plan. Families are required to save a portion of their paycheck, SSI check, TANF (cash assistance), or or other income, to aid in the attainment of housing. The amount to be saved will be determined by the family and their case manager.
  • Compliance and/or participation with the Lawrence Housing Authority programs and guidelines.
  • Participation in random drug screening.

All program requirements are intended to empower families financially, socially, and emotionally. The following services will be provided by LCS, with the focus on strengthening and supporting the family bond.

  • Family Preservation referral within two weeks of arrival
  • RADAC assessment and referral in response to a positive UA
  • Parenting education services. F.Y.I. (Family and Youth Intervention Services) has committed to providing sessions with all families at LCS
  • Parents will have access to the kitchen area daily, to prepare meals for their family
  • A designated area is given to children for supervised nap time each day
  • Parents are given a storage area for their groceries purchased by them with food stamps
  • Parents and children are given a designated area for supervised playtime, located in the downstairs area of the shelter
  • Parents are given lists of childcare providers in the area
  • Parents are given assistance in filling out applications for food stamps, health insurance, cash assistance, and others as needed
  • Families have a case manager that only works with families
  • Counseling is available for families
  • Drug and alcohol abuse services and referrals are also available

Families are required to fully participate in, and with LCS Family Program. This program is designed to enhance, restore, and adjust all family members. Abuse of any kind will not be tolerated, and will be reported to the appropriate authority. LCS house rules will be strictly enforced. Failure to comply with LCS Family Program requirements and/or LCS house rules will result in immediate termination of program eligibility. Families are required to have medical documentation for children staying at LCS, including immunization records and a medical release form. All appointments (i.e. medical, legal, etc.) must be reported to the LCS Family Program case manager. Supervision of children staying at LCS is the sole responsibility of the parent(s). Childcare will not be provided by LCS staff by any circumstances. Assistance in contacting the families EES worker to request childcare assistance will be provided.

Your guest status and all personal information you provide to LCS is private. Certain demographic information, such as age, sex, and veteran status, may be tallied so that we can describe the guest population and assess needs for future services. No names or other identifying data will be included in these statistics.

The LCS Family Program does cooperate with all medical facilities (LMH, Bert Nash, Health Department, Dentist), Lawrence Police Department, SRS, and other agencies as necessary.
